i know you solved your peoblem,but you might want to clean your ps2 lens.you said the other backup was choppy(i over read this).when you have read problems like that sometimes its a dirty lens.you could get different media to work but your ps2 lens may still be alittle dirty.and maybe adjusting the speed would have helped.but anyway, definitely clean your lens it is something you should do on a regular basis anyway.
and i replaced the padme file because i was bored and fooling around with stuff.i also copied it with the padme file as comparison.it feels like it plays better without the file,but it is hardly noticeable to tell you the truth.
